اطلاعات تماس

اهواز - کیانپارس - خیابان ۳ شرقی - ساختمان محمد - طبقه دوم - واحد ۶

061-91010061

sales@irhosting24.com

حساب کاربری
روش های Minification و تاثیر آن بر سئو سایت

آشنایی با روش های Minification

روش های Minification روش های متنوعی هستند. Minification به فرایند کاهش حجم فایل های HTML، CSS و JavaScript بدون تغییر در عملکرد آنها گفته می شود. این کار باعث می شود سرعت بارگذاری صفحات وب افزایش یافته و بهبود عملکرد وب سایت را در بر داشته باشد که در تعریف حرفه ای همان سئو یا بهینه سازی موتورهای جستجو است (به فرایند افزایش دیدگاه وب سایت در نتایج جستجو گفته می شود.) سئو شامل فنون و راهکارهایی است که به وب سایت کمک می کند تا برای کلمات کلیدی مرتبط با محتوای خود رتبه بالاتری کسب کند.

در مقاله حاضر در وب سایت ایران هاستینگ 24 قصد داریم تا شما را با روش های Minification و تاثیر آن بر سئو سایت آشنا کنیم. با ما همراه باشید.

روش های Minification و تاثیر آن بر سئو سایت

همان طور که گفته شد روش های Minification متنوع هستند. لود سایت به زمان مورد نیاز برای نمایش محتوای یک صفحه وب در مرورگر کاربر گفته می شود. لود سایت تاثیر بسزایی بر رضایت کاربر، نرخ تبدیل، رتبه بندی سئو و عملکرد کلی وب سایت دارد . بنابراین، minification یکی از روش های بهینه سازی سرعت لود سایت است که به نوبه خود تاثیر مستقیم بر سئو دارد. با minification می توانید حجم فایل های خود را کاهش داده و زمان پاسخگویی سرور خود را افزایش دهید.

این باعث می شود صفحات سایت سریع تر بارگذاری شده و تجربه کاربری بهتری را ارائه دهید. برای انجام minification هم تعدادی ابزار آنلاین وجود دارد و هم تعدادی افزونه برای سایتهای وردپرسی طراحی شده است. این ابزارها کمک می کنند تا فایلهای CSS , HTML , JS سایت خود را فشرده کرده و کدهای اضافی ، فاصله ها، توضیحات و نشانه گذاری های غیرضروری را انجام دهید. انجام این روش در هاست های اشتراکی و یا سرور های مجازی می تواند مصرف منابع سرور را کاهش داده و سرعت لود سایت را به شدت افزایش دهد.

ابزارهای آنلاین برای Minification

HTML Minifier: یک ابزار ساده و رایگان برای فشرده سازی فایل های HTML.

JavaScript Minifie: یک ابزار کارآمد و مطمئن برای فشرده سازی فایل های JavaScript.

Minifier CSS : یک ابزار قدرتمند برای فشرده سازی فایل های CSS

متدهای Minify کردن CSS

یکی از روش های Minification استفاده از ابزار های آنلاین است. برای کاربرانی که آشنایی زیادی با کدهای CSS ندارند بهترین روش کوچک کردن فایل CSS استفاده از ابزار آنلاین است. چرا که بدون داشتن دانش پیش زمینه ، فایل اصلی CSS شما را کوچک کرده و تحویل میدهد. البته باوجود اینکه این روش کار میکند ولی واقعیت این است که برای پروژه های واقعی بزرگ روش پیشنهاد شده ای نمی باشد.

https://www.minifier.org https://cssminifier.com

https://www.cleancss.com/css-minify

https://www.toptal.com/developers/cssminifier

تمامی این ابزارها رابط کاربری ساده و صریحی دارند و کار با آنها بسیار آسان است. کافی است کد CSS خود را در جعبه متن باز شده کپی کنید.

چگونه می توان سطح minification را تنظیم کرد؟

بعد از آشنایی با روش های Minification می خواهیم بدانیم تنظیمات آن را چگونه باید مدیریت کرد. سطح minification را می توانید با توجه به نیاز و هدف خود تنظیم کنید. برای مثال، اگر می خواهید سرعت لود سایت خود را به حداکثر برسانید، می توانید از سطح بالای minification استفاده کنید که باعث می شود فایل های خود را به شدت فشرده سازی کنید. اما اگر می خواهید کد های خود را قابل خواندن و ویرایش نگه دارید، می توانید از سطح پایین یا متوسط minification استفاده کنید که باعث می شود فقط کدهای غیر ضروری را حذف کنید.

برای تنظیم سطح minification می توانید از گزینه های مختلف ابزارها یا افزونه های minification استفاده کنید. برخی از این گزینه ها عبارتند از: حذف توضیحات: با فعال کردن این گزینه، می توانید تمام توضیحات را از فایل های خود حذف کنید حذف فضاهای خالی: با فعال کردن این گزینه، می توانید تمام فضاهای خالی، خطوط جدید و تب ها را از فایل های خود حذف کنید.

کوتاه کردن نام های متغیر: با فعال کردن این گزینه، می توانید نام های متغیر و تابع را با نام های کوتاه تر جایگزین کنید حذف نقطه ویرگول: با فعال کردن این گزینه، می توانید نقطه ویرگول های غیر ضروری را از فایل های JavaScript خود حذف کنید Packaging CSS: با فعال کردن این گزینه، می توانید قوانین CSS را به صورت گروه بندی شده و بهینه شده نمایش دهید.

امیدواریم مقاله روش های Minification برای شما مفید بوده باشد.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*